A governor has revised a speech for a local community center. Which change is most appropriate?

Explanation:
Communicating clearly to a local community audience means using language that is easy to understand and free of unnecessary jargon. When technical ideas are explained in general terms, listeners can grasp the main points without getting lost in specialized vocabulary. This approach often uses plain language, simple definitions, and relatable examples or analogies that connect to everyday life, helping everyone follow the message and stay engaged. While other tweaks can be helpful in different ways, plain-language explanations directly address the core goal of understanding. Adding references to other speakers or using visuals can support comprehension or emphasis, but they don’t guarantee that complex concepts will be understood if the language itself remains overly technical. Removing information risks leaving out important details the audience deserves. By translating technical concepts into general terms, the speaker makes the message accessible to the widest possible audience, which is crucial in a community setting.
